Hi I Have a Adata SX6000 m.2 250Gb and i am experiencing 100% Disk Usage And I Have Tried DisablingWindows search and all of those and also tried disabling Diag Track.Im also experiencing high cpu usage idling at about 15-25% i have a Ryzen 5 2600


update atm it looks like everything has gone stable i have a idle cpu at 1% and disk usage is around 0-3 $ at times but as soon as i try to download or install games my disk usage jumps back to 100% and my computer slows down alot

unknown.png


is this normal?

Installing games require a lot of memory and space. To ensure the stability of your installation, the process should be given high priority. So it is normal for a PC to show high disk usage. Close all other background process and antimalwares if any. Your defender might interfere with some installations, so disable it before running the setup.
 
is the Adata your only drive?

If you cloned from an earlier SATA drive, it's possible you are missing correct NVME drivers..

Within device mngr, look under 'Storage COntrollers" and see if you see your 'Adata NVME' or similar listed...(I don't see anything from Adata that implies a unique NVME driver is available, so, perhaps a generic Microsoft NVME drive will show under 'storage devices'?
